소스 검색

审批2.0增加审批角色

guarantee-lsq 7 달 전
부모
커밋
71b0e54526
1개의 변경된 파일4개의 추가작업 그리고 0개의 파일을 삭제
  1. 4 0
      platform-service/src/main/java/com/platform/service/workflow/impl/WorkflowServiceImpl.java

+ 4 - 0
platform-service/src/main/java/com/platform/service/workflow/impl/WorkflowServiceImpl.java

@@ -93,6 +93,7 @@ public class WorkflowServiceImpl extends BaseServiceImpl<WorkflowMapper, Workflo
         workflow.setUpdateTime(LocalDateTime.now());
         workflow.setUpdateUserId(SecurityUtils.getUserInfo().getUserId());
         workflow.setUpdateUserName(SecurityUtils.getUserInfo().getRealName());
+        workflow.setName(workflowDTO.getName());
         mapper.updateByPrimaryKeySelective(workflow);
         workflowNodeMapper.insertListforComplex(nodeList);
     }
@@ -159,6 +160,9 @@ public class WorkflowServiceImpl extends BaseServiceImpl<WorkflowMapper, Workflo
                         if(StringUtils.isBlank(deptId)){
                             throw new DeniedException("角色所属部门ID-deptId不能为空");
                         }
+                        node.setNodeFilterModel(filterModel);
+                        node.setRoleId(roleId);
+                        node.setDeptId(deptId);
                     }
                     break;
             }